simple, the window benefits from several breakthrough technological innovations, namely:
- simple, the INVISIBLE window: a hidden frame, invisible hinges and handles lacquered in the color of the carpentry for greater purity.
- simple, the THIN window: 45mm profiles and a 60mm central mullion, 30% to 40% thinner than a standard window (90 to 100mm most commonly) for a light gain of up to 35% .
- simple, the SOLID window: a welded steel sash to reach non-standard dimensions up to 2.650 mm in height without transom or lighter.
In terms of performance, simple the window defies all other materials on the market with a thermal coefficient Uw of 1.2 W/(m².K) benefited by a switch per thermal chamber which allows hot and cold air to be isolated for greater comfort .

In what way is simple the window an innovation concerning invisibility?
"To make this window pretty, it had to be pure! We therefore made the cut lines invisible thanks to a welded sash, lacquered the handle in the color of the sash. Finally, the hinges and the frame are hidden and helps to have a more minimalist window.”
...and finesse?
"Today, the observation made on the market is simple: the majority of 2-leaf windows have a central profile of 94 mm. Our wish is to bring much more light and we have succeeded in offering 35% of light in addition thanks to the central profile of 60 mm and the sash of 45 mm. "
...and solidity?
"Being the inventor of the multi-material concept, we master it perfectly and to meet the new demands of our customers - more robustness, more safety, larger dimensions - we therefore quite naturally made the choice to combine aluminum to steel. By coupling these 2 materials to a welded steel sash, we can now offer large windows up to 2,65 m high without transom!"
